Mrs. Jane Madden

August 2, 1943 - October 24, 2015

Mrs. Jane Dye Madden, 72, of Elberton, passed away Saturday, October 24, 2015 at Spring Valley Private Home Care. A native of Elberton, Mrs. Madden was the daughter of the late George Jackson Dye, Jr. and the late Mary Fay Fleming Dye. She was the wife of George Frank Madden, having celebrated over 53 years of marriage together. Mrs. Madden was a homemaker and a member of Fortsonia Baptist Church. In addition to her husband, George Frank Madden, Mrs. Madden is survived by a son, Brent Madden and his wife, Michelle, of Jefferson; a grandson, Patrick Madden; a brother, Jackson B. Dye and his wife, Teresa, of Elberton; and a number of nieces and nephews. A memorial service to celebrate Mrs. Madden’s life was held on Monday, October 26th at Fortsonia Baptist Church at 3:00 p.m. with Rev. Ben Glosson, Rev. Al Butler, and Rev. Tim Adams officiating. The family received friends at the church just prior to the service. In lieu of flowers, memorials may be made to The Alzheimer's Foundation of America, 322 Eighth Ave., 7th Floor., New York, NY 10001, or Fortsonia Baptist Church at 2616 Washington Hwy., Elberton, Georgia 30635.
